Game story
In Week 7 of the 2000 NFL season on 2000-10-15, the Green Bay Packers took care of business against the San Francisco 49ers, pulling away with a 31–28 final that came down to the wire.
The highest-scoring period was Q4 with 24 combined points — the stretch that most shaped the final margin.

How it unfolded, quarter by quarter
A quarter-by-quarter recap built from live scoring plays and play descriptions.
The opening quarter: Green Bay Packers won the period 7–0. Green Bay Packers found the end zone from the SF 67 (Q1 47:30) — (2:30) B.Favre pass to A.Freeman for 67 yards, TOUCHDOWN.; Green Bay Packers added 1 points from the SF 2 (Q1 47:17) — R.Longwell extra point is GOOD, Center-R.Davis, Holder-M.Hasselbeck..
The second quarter: The quarter finished even at 7–7. San Francisco 49ers found the end zone from the GB 39 (Q2 35:27) — (5:27) J.Garcia pass to C.Garner for 39 yards, TOUCHDOWN.; San Francisco 49ers added 1 points from the GB 2 (Q2 35:27) — W.Richey extra point is GOOD, Center-B.Jennings, Holder-C.Stanley.; Green Bay Packers found the end zone from the SF 2 (Q2 30:57) — (:57) A.Green left tackle for 2 yards, TOUCHDOWN. Play Challenged by Replay Official and Upheld.; Green Bay Packers added 1 points from the SF 2 (Q2 30:51) — R.Longwell extra point is GOOD, Center-R.Davis, Holder-M.Hasselbeck..
The third quarter: The quarter finished even at 7–7. Green Bay Packers found the end zone from the SF 1 (Q3 23:51) — (8:51) D.Levens up the middle for 1 yard, TOUCHDOWN.; Green Bay Packers added 1 points from the SF 2 (Q3 23:51) — R.Longwell extra point is GOOD, Center-R.Davis, Holder-M.Hasselbeck.; San Francisco 49ers found the end zone from the GB 23 (Q3 17:10) — (2:10) J.Garcia pass to J.Stokes for 23 yards, TOUCHDOWN.; San Francisco 49ers added 1 points from the GB 2 (Q3 17:10) — W.Richey extra point is GOOD, Center-B.Jennings, Holder-C.Stanley..
The fourth quarter: San Francisco 49ers won the period 14–10. San Francisco 49ers found the end zone from the GB 16 (Q4 11:36) — (11:36) J.Garcia pass to T.Owens for 16 yards, TOUCHDOWN.; San Francisco 49ers added 1 points from the GB 2 (Q4 11:36) — W.Richey extra point is GOOD, Center-B.Jennings, Holder-C.Stanley.; Green Bay Packers found the end zone from the SF 1 (Q4 8:01) — (8:01) A.Green right guard for 1 yard, TOUCHDOWN.; Green Bay Packers added 1 points from the SF 2 (Q4 8:01) — R.Longwell extra point is GOOD, Center-R.Davis, Holder-M.Hasselbeck.; San Francisco 49ers found the end zone from the GB 37 (Q4 5:30) — (5:30) J.Garcia pass to T.Owens for 37 yards, TOUCHDOWN.; San Francisco 49ers added 1 points from the GB 2 (Q4 5:30) — W.Richey extra point is GOOD, Center-B.Jennings, Holder-C.Stanley.; Green Bay Packers connected on a field goal from the SF 17 (Q4 0:54) — (:54) R.Longwell 35 yard field goal is GOOD, Center-R.Davis, Holder-M.Hasselbeck..
